About Tea-cup Cottage

Founded in 2010, Tea-Cup Cottage began as a way to provide choice and control over disability support services for families. Their mission is to enrich the quality of life for people with disabilities, helping them live independently with a trustworthy helping hand when needed.
  
An NDIS-registered disability support provider, Tea-Cup Cottage assists children and adults with disabilities across Southeast Queensland and Toowoomba. The organisation delivers a full suite of services including short-term accommodation, in-home support, community access, day programs, Supported Independent Living (SIL), and Specialist Disability Accommodation (SDA).
  
Tea-Cup Cottage has a strong culture built on loyalty, family-first values, continuous growth, wisdom, and curiosity. The organisation values teamwork, personal development, and operational excellence while supporting sustainable business growth.

About the role

The Chief Operating Officer (COO) will report directly to the CEO and be a key member of the Executive Leadership Team. This is a hands-on executive role responsible for overseeing operations across all business units, including aged care and disability services, and ensuring alignment between operational performance and strategic objectives.
  
The COO will implement accountability frameworks, drive operational efficiency, optimise Microsoft 365 and business systems, and lead cross-functional teams to deliver measurable improvements. This role requires balancing strategic oversight with practical execution while fostering a positive, collaborative culture.
  
Key focus areas include continuous improvement initiatives, operational efficiency, cost optimisation, and adoption of best practices for scalable growth. The COO will work closely with the CFO to manage budgets, track financial performance, and ensure compliance with regulatory frameworks such as NDIS, My Aged Care, and Child Safety legislation.
  
Additionally, the COO will play a pivotal role in shaping the organisational culture by mentoring senior managers, promoting leadership development, and ensuring alignment across all teams. They will act as a catalyst for innovation, identifying opportunities to streamline processes, implement technology-driven solutions, and enhance service delivery. This role requires a leader who can translate strategic vision into actionable plans while maintaining a strong focus on the people, processes, and systems that underpin sustainable growth and operational excellence.
